Solid Construction and Material Quality

The rubber pad is crafted from dense, high-friction rubber, which feels substantial in hand. This choice of material ensures a durable grip that can withstand repeated use without tearing or flattening. The weight and texture provide a reassuring sense of quality, which is essential for a component that needs to reliably prevent camera twist. Moreover, the rubber’s flexibility allows it to conform slightly around the tripod plate, improving fit and friction.

Design for Compatibility and Ease of Setup

The pad features a slightly textured surface with ridges designed to grip the camera’s tripod mount snugly. Its dimensions are optimized for common tripod plates, although it may not fit some heavier or unusually shaped models. Installing the pad involves peeling off a protective backing and sticking it onto the tripod plate, which is straightforward and quick—taking less than a minute. The adhesive is strong enough to keep it in place during shoots but not so aggressive as to complicate removal or repositioning.

Potential Shortcomings and Design Flaws

One minor annoyance is that the pad’s adhesive does not appear to be washable or reusable. If it becomes dirty or loses tack, it might need replacement, which adds to long-term costs. Additionally, the pad’s thickness—approximately 2mm—although generally beneficial, can interfere with precise tripod leveling if the setup requires fine adjustments. This small obstruction might necessitate compensatory tweaks to ensure perfect framing.

Lighting Kits Showdown: Budget vs. Professional Equipment

When it comes to lighting, the Inspire LED Panel offers a versatile, budget-friendly option, competing with premium brands like the Aputure Light Storm LS C300d II. While the Inspire panel delivers decent brightness at a fraction of the cost—approximately $250 compared to the $1,200 price tag of the Aputure—it lacks some advanced features such as extensive color calibration and DMX control. Content creators on a tight budget might prefer the Inspire for its ease of use and affordability, but professionals demanding precise color grading and robust build quality will lean toward the Aputure for its superior output consistency and build robustness.

Camera Reviews: Entry-Level vs. High-End Models

Looking at camera options, the Canon EOS R10 provides excellent value with advanced autofocus and 4K recording at a price point around $980. For comparison, the Sony A7 IV offers higher-end features like 4K 60fps and superior low-light performance but commands a premium of nearly $2,500. If budget constraints are a priority, the Canon R10 delivers nearly comparable image quality with user-friendly features, making it a compelling choice. However, for professional studios where image fidelity can’t be compromised, the Sony A7 IV’s higher dynamic range and better sensor performance justify the higher investment.

Microphone Reviews: Budget vs. Professional Solutions

The Rode VideoMic Pro is a popular mid-range shotgun microphone priced around $220, competing with more affordable options like the Deity V-Mic D3 Pro at about $150. While the Deity offers excellent sound quality and adjustable gain, the Rode’s build quality and brand reputation are hard to beat, especially for outdoor shooting with its built-in windscreen. For creators needing broadcast-quality audio, investing in the Rode makes sense despite its higher price—offering reliability and better long-term support. On the other hand, entry-level microphones might suffice for casual vlogging or hobbyist projects but fall short when professional sound fidelity is needed.
